George C. Kiriakopoulos

June 3, 1926 — October 21, 2017

Dr. George C. Kiriakopoulos passed away on Saturday, October 21, 2017. Born in Derby, CT to Konstantine and Triatafilia Kiriakopoulos, he was raised in Brooklyn, NY.
He joined the United States Army as a ranger in 1944 and landed at Omaha Beach in Normandy, France helping to liberate Paris. As a Sargent Major, he fought in the Battle of the Bulge and was the 4th soldier to enter and liberate Buchenwald.
After the war, he stayed in Paris, receiving his Associate Degree from the Sorbonne in Art.
Upon his return from Europe, he entered Brooklyn College and proceeded to be accepted to Columbia University School of Dentistry. He had a private practice in dentistry in Fort Lee and was a professor of dentistry at Columbia Dental School as well as being on the Admissions Committee.
He was a member of the Church of the Ascension in Fairview and then a became a member of the Parish Council. Dr. Kiriakopoulos was the President of the Metropolitan Church of St. John the Theologian in Tenafly for three years.
He was bestowed the honor of Archon of the Ecumenical Patriarchate.
He is the author of several books on dentistry and World War II including Ten Days to Destiny, The Battle for Crete and the Nazi Occupation of Crete.
George is survived by his beloved wife Virginia (nee Demos) and his loving daughter Stephanie.
